Keto Garlic Parmesan Wings

Indulge in the perfect blend of crispy, juicy chicken wings coated in a rich garlic Parmesan sauce that will tantalize your taste buds. These Keto Garlic Parmesan Wings are not only a guilt-free appetizer or main course but also a celebration of flavor and texture. With a delightful crunch and a savory finish, they’re perfect for game day, gatherings, or simply a satisfying treat at home. This dish has roots in the classic buffalo wing tradition but takes a delicious detour into the keto realm, making it suitable for those watching their carb intake.

Serves 4

Ingredients

Chicken wings
2 pounds
Unsalted butter
1/2 cup, melted
Garlic powder
2 teaspoons
Grated Parmesan cheese
1 cup
Salt
1 teaspoon
Black pepper
1/2 teaspoon
Fresh parsley
2 tablespoons, chopped (for garnish)

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C).
  2. In a large mixing bowl, combine the melted butter, garlic powder, grated Parmesan cheese, salt, and black pepper. Mix well until a smooth paste forms.
  3. Pat the chicken wings dry with paper towels to ensure they become extra crispy. Place them on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per.
  4. Using a brush or your hands, coat both sides of the chicken wings generously with the garlic Parmesan mixture.
  5. Arrange the wings in a single layer on the baking sheet to promote even cooking.
  6. Bake in the preheated oven for 25-30 minutes, or until the wings are golden brown and crispy, and the internal temperature reaches 165°F (74°C).
  7. Once done, remove from the oven and let them rest for a few minutes.
  8. Sprinkle the chopped parsley over the wings for a fresh touch and serve immediately.

Tips

  • 💡 For an extra kick, add a teaspoon of cayenne pepper to the garlic Parmesan mixture.
  • 💡 If you prefer a different cheese, try using Pecorino Romano for a sharper flavor.
  • 💡 Serve with a side of keto-friendly ranch or blue cheese dressing for dipping.

Dietary Information

Servings: 4 Dish Type: Appetizer/Main Course Prep Time: 10 minutes Cook Time: 30 minutes Calories: 460 Fat: 36g Carbs: 2g Protein: 34g Sodium: 800mg Sugar: 0g
